How Often Do You Need to Change Your Oil?

At what intervals should vehicle owners perform oil changes? This is a common concern for both car enthusiasts and regular drivers. Generally, manufacturers recommend changing engine oil every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, however some contemporary vehicles may push this interval to 10,000 miles or further depending on specific conditions. Factors influencing oil change frequency include driving habits, climate, and the type of oil used. As an example, drivers who regularly navigate heavy traffic or operate vehicles in harsh weather conditions may need to change their oil more often. Additionally, synthetic oils tend to provide better protection and can extend intervals between changes. Regularly checking the oil level and its overall quality is critical; oil that appears dark and contains grit is a clear sign that a change is overdue. In the end, sticking to a consistent oil change routine is crucial for preserving engine integrity, maximizing vehicle performance, and extending the life of your car, making it a fundamental element of conscientious vehicle ownership.

What Can You Expect from a Full Service Oil Change?

A thorough full service oil change usually covers several essential components aimed at maintaining maximum engine efficiency. First, the service involves extracting the aged engine oil, which is then replaced with high-quality, manufacturer-recommended oil. The oil filter is also replaced to guarantee that impurities do not flow through the engine.

Beyond these main duties, technicians often conduct a thorough multi-point evaluation, examining hoses, belts, and fluid levels for signs of wear and tear. They will also examine the engine air filter and cabin air filter, replacing them if necessary.

Some repair shops provide supplementary services, such as tyre rotation, brake inspection, and even a cleaning or vacuuming of the automobile's interior, boosting comprehensive vehicle maintenance. This all-inclusive approach not only sustains the health of the engine but also contributes to the lifespan of other critical systems within the vehicle.

Understanding When to Plan Your Next Full Oil Change Service

At what point should car owners think about booking their next complete oil change service? Typically, experts suggest every 3,000 to 7,500 miles, depending on the vehicle's make and model, as well as the type of oil used. Monitoring the vehicle's oil level and quality is essential; if the oil appears dark or gritty, it may indicate the need for a change sooner. Additionally, owners should take note of the vehicle's performance. Unusual noises, decreased fuel efficiency, or warning lights on the dashboard might suggest that an oil change is due. Seasonal changes can also impact the timing; for instance, harsh winters can necessitate more frequent changes. In closing, reviewing the owner's manual delivers personalized guidance suited to the vehicle, promoting top performance and durability. Regularly scheduling oil changes is a proactive measure to maintain engine health and avoid costly repairs down the line.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I Get Other Services During a Full Service Oil Change?

Yes, several service centers provide complementary services during a comprehensive oil change. These often include tire rotation and balancing, fluid top-offs and inspections, and air filter replacements, providing a great chance for thorough vehicle upkeep in a single visit.

What Type of Oil Is Used in a Full Service Oil Change?

Usually, a comprehensive oil change incorporates either conventional, synthetic blend, or full synthetic oil. The option chosen is based on the automobile's needs and the driver's preferences, ensuring optimal performance and engine care during use.

What Is the Duration of a Full Service Oil Change?

A full service oil change typically takes between 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the shop's efficiency and additional services requested. Factors like vehicle type and oil choice can further affect the total time.

Do I Need an Appointment for a Full Service Oil Change?

Booking an appointment for a full service oil change is usually suggested, ensuring the service center can accommodate the vehicle promptly. Nevertheless, numerous locations also welcome walk-in customers, giving options to those with urgent service requirements.

Do Full Service Oil Changes Cost More Than Standard Oil Changes?

Full service oil changes tend to be priced higher than standard oil changes owing to the supplementary services they encompass, like filter replacements and fluid inspections. This higher price reflects the comprehensive attention given to your vehicle's upkeep.
